



















Find the index of the array element you want to remove, then remove that index with splice.
The splice() method changes the contents of an array by removing existing elements and/or adding new elements.
var array = [2, 5, 9];
console.log(array)
var index = array.indexOf(5);
if (index > -1) {
array.splice(index, 1);
}
// array = [2, 9]
console.log(array);
The second parameter of splice is the number of elements to remove. Note that splicemodifies the array in place and returns a new array containing the elements that have been removed.
